Key Features
- Cross-platform support: Windows, macOS, Linux
- Both GUI and command line modes available
- Ultra-fast processing for large files and millions of rows
- 100% local processing to protect data privacy
- Flexible settings: encoding, delimiters, headers, column mapping
- Support batch merging and automation via scheduled tasks
How to Merge CSV Files in 4 Steps
- Launch the tool, create a new task, and select CSV as the source format. Add multiple CSV files or an entire folder. 📷
- Configure source file options: encoding, delimiter, header row, and preview data to ensure correctness. 📷
- Set the output path and name for the merged CSV file. Adjust output encoding and column structure as needed. 📷
- Click run to start merging. View real-time progress and open the output file directly when finished. 📷
Automation & Command Line
For advanced users and repeated tasks:
- Finish a merge task in GUI mode and save the session.
- Export a .bat (Windows) or .sh (macOS/Linux) script. 📷
- Schedule the script using Windows Task Scheduler or Linux crontab.
- Automate CSV merging daily, weekly, or on any custom schedule.
Frequently Asked Questions
How long does it take to merge CSV files?
The tool processes data extremely fast. It can handle millions of rows in minutes.
Is my data secure when merging CSV files?
Absolutely secure. All operations run locally on your computer; files are never uploaded to any server.
Does it support command line on multiple operating systems?
Yes. It supports command line mode on Windows, macOS, and Linux.
Can I merge or convert multiple CSV files in batch?
Yes. You can merge or convert multiple CSV files at once efficiently.
Merge Your CSV Files Today
Download Withdata DataFileConverter to merge your CSV files easily and efficiently.
Download DataFileConverter
×
Download DataFileConverter